Excise Department destroys 2530 liters of Lahan, one arrested

Jammu , 05 May 2020

In view of the complaints of illicit distillation due to closure of wine shops, Excise Department constituted different teams to tighten noose against the violators and book them under Excise Act.In Rajouri-Poonch Excise Range, the team conducted a raid at Muradpur village during which one person namely Anil Kumar S/o Bodh Raj was arrested for possession of 02 bottles of illicit liquor. About 30 liters of illicit liquors Lahan was also recovered and destroyed on the spot.Another raid was conducted by Excise Range Kathua at Kangdyal, Dhabwal, Upper Sakthachak, Persochak, Banyari, Labdhuchak, Sunjwan and Chibbachak. About 2500 Kgs of Lahan, raw material of illicit liquor was recovered and destroyed on spot.Excise Commissioner Rajesh Kumar Shavan said that even the department is verifying the stocks of wine shops to check any type of malpractice. He informed that so far around 60 shops have been verified and re-sealed.The officers who conducted the raids included Virender Pawar, ETO Excise Range Rajouri-Poonch, Virender Kumar ETO Excise Range Kathua, alongwith Inspectors Arun Kumar, Razi Ahmed, Mohd Pervaiz, Sub-Inspectors Anil Sharma, Karamat Ali, Amit Sharma and Excise Guards Jyoti Prakash Sharma, Barun Sharma.
